Job Summary

This role is ideal for an experienced engineer specializing in measurement and control technology, focusing heavily on analog and digital circuit design. Day-to-day responsibilities include developing complex circuitry, managing projects from the initial concept and prototyping phases through to final series production readiness, and ensuring elect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) compliance. A key aspect of the job involves creating EMC-compliant designs for (high-frequency) circuits and conducting rigorous measurements, tests, and qualifications. The successful candidate will also be responsible for coordinating technical specifications and development progress with internal departments. Required qualifications include a degree or technician qualification in Electrical Engineering or Telecommunications, coupled with professional experience in circuit design, commissioning, and familiarity with standard measurement equipment. Fluency in German and good English skills are essential for communication.
